Lloydy,
Part of Post Traumatic Stress Disorder is re-enacting your abuse, sometimes in a ritualistic way.
The acting out you describe sounds to me like that type of a response to the stress of the abuses you endured.
I would be working on PTSD type stuff with your therapist and i bet in time those fantasies would diminish if not dissapear completely.
